A History of Brain Asymmetry Studies

Author(s):  
Stephen D. Christman

The history of the study of brain asymmetry and hemispheric specialization is reviewed, starting with Broca’s initial discovery of the left frontal basis for speech, continuing through Sperry’s work with “split-brain” patients, and ending with the componential approach that emerged in the 1980s in which the pursuit of an “ultimate dichotomy” underlying hemispheric specialization was finally abandoned and a new emphasis on hemispheric division of labor was introduced. Special emphasis is given to methodological considerations of the use of dichotic listening and tachistoscopic divided visual half-field paradigms. In addition, the topics of interhemispheric interaction and handedness are discussed, with a particular emphasis on the importance of conceptualizing handedness in terms of both direction (left versus right) and degree (strong/consistent versus mixed/inconsistent).

AbstractThe transition from unicellular to multicellular organisms is one of the most significant events in the history of life. Key to this process is the emergence of Darwinian individuality at the higher level: groups must become single entities capable of reproduction for selection to shape their evolution. Evolutionary transitions in individuality are characterized by cooperation between the lower level entities and by division of labor. Theory suggests that division of labor may drive the transition to multicellularity by eliminating the trade-off between two incompatible processes that cannot be performed simultaneously in one cell. Here we examine the evolution of the most ancient multicellular transition known today, that of cyanobacteria, where we reconstruct the sequence of ecological and phenotypic trait evolution. Our results show that the prime driver of multicellularity in cyanobacteria was the expansion in metabolic capacity offered by nitrogen fixation, which was accompanied by the emergence of the filamentous morphology and succeeded by a reproductive life cycle. This was followed by the progression of multicellularity into higher complexity in the form of differentiated cells and patterned multicellularity.Significance StatementThe emergence of multicellularity is a major evolutionary transition. The oldest transition, that of cyanobacteria, happened more than 3 to 3.5 billion years ago. We find N2 fixation to be the prime driver of multicellularity in cyanobacteria. This innovation faced the challenge of incompatible metabolic processes since the N2 fixing enzyme (nitrogenase) is sensitive to oxygen, which is abundantly found in cyanobacteria cells performing photosynthesis. At the same time, N2-fixation conferred an adaptive benefit to the filamentous morphology as cells could divide their labour into performing either N2-fixation or photosynthesis. This was followed by the culmination of complex multicellularity in the form of differentiated cells and patterned multicellularity.

The largest fibre tract in the human brain connects the two cerebral hemispheres. A ‘split-brain’ surgery severs this structure, sometimes together with other white matter tracts connecting the right hemisphere and the left. Split-brain surgeries have long been performed on non-human animals for experimental purposes, but a number of these surgeries were also performed on adult human beings in the second half of the twentieth century, as a medical treatment for severe cases of epilepsy. A number of these people afterwards agreed to participate in ongoing research into the psychobehavioural consequences of the procedure. These experiments have helped to show that the corpus callosum is a significant source of interhemispheric interaction and information exchange in the ‘neurotypical’ brain. After split-brain surgery, the two hemispheres operate unusually independently of each other in the realm of perception, cognition, and the control of action. For instance, each hemisphere receives visual information directly from the opposite (‘contralateral’) side of space, the right hemisphere from the left visual field and the left hemisphere from the right visual field. This is true of the normal (‘neurotypical’) brain too, but in the neurotypical case interhemispheric tracts allow either hemisphere to gain access to the information that the other has received. In a split-brain subject however the information more or less stays put in whatever hemisphere initially received it. And it isn’t just visual information that is confined to one hemisphere or the other after the surgery. Rather, after split-brain surgery, each hemisphere is the source of proprietary perceptual information of various kinds, and is also the source of proprietary memories, intentions, and aptitudes. Various notions of psychological unity or integration have always been central to notions of mind, personhood, and the self. Although split-brain surgery does not prevent interhemispheric interaction or exchange, it naturally alters and impedes it. So does the split-brain subject as a whole nonetheless remain a unitary psychological being? Or could there now be two such psychological beings within one human animal – sharing one body, one face, one voice? Prominent neuropsychologists working with the subjects have often appeared to argue or assume that a split-brain subject has a divided or disunified consciousness and even two minds. Although a number of philosophers agree, the majority seem to have resisted these conscious and mental ‘duality claims’, defending alternative interpretations of the split-brain experimental results. The sources of resistance are diverse, including everything from a commitment to the necessary unity of consciousness, to recognition of those psychological processes that remain interhemispherically integrated, to concerns about what the moral and legal consequences would be of recognizing multiple psychological beings in one body. On the other hand underlying most of these arguments against the various ‘duality’ claims is the simple fact that the split-brain subject does not appear to be two persons, but one – and there are powerful conceptual, social, and moral connections between being a unitary person on the one hand and having a unified consciousness and mind on the other.

In the history of religions, material artifacts have often played an important role as mediations of the ‘sacred.’ They were and are worshipped, venerated, and sometimes destroyed for their assumed supernatural powers. The article reviews theoretical concepts that engage with the charismatic capacities of objects (‘fetish,’ ‘cultic image,’ and ‘aura’) and discusses literature about ‘charismatic objects.’ It deals with the question of what kind of charisma objects may have and suggests that the term ‘charisma,’ when defined in a specific way, is a useful concept to describe and compare specific material objects from different religious traditions. These conceptual and methodological considerations are illustrated by a brief discussion of Christian relic veneration.

Co-morbid insomnia and sleep apnea (COMISA) is a highly prevalent and debilitating disorder, which results in additive impairments to patients’ sleep, daytime functioning, and quality of life, and complex diagnostic and treatment decisions for clinicians. Although the presence of COMISA was first recognized by Christian Guilleminault and colleagues in 1973, it received very little research attention for almost three decades, until the publication of two articles in 1999 and 2001 which collectively reported a 30%–50% co-morbid prevalence rate, and re-ignited research interest in the field. Since 1999, there has been an exponential increase in research documenting the high prevalence, common characteristics, treatment complexities, and bi-directional relationships of COMISA. Recent trials indicate that co-morbid insomnia symptoms may be treated with cognitive and behavioral therapy for insomnia, to increase acceptance and use of continuous positive airway pressure therapy. Hence, the treatment of COMISA appears to require nuanced diagnostic considerations, and multi-faceted treatment approaches provided by multi-disciplinary teams of psychologists and physicians. In this narrative review, we present a brief overview of the history of COMISA research, describe the importance of measuring and managing insomnia symptoms in the presence of sleep apnea, discuss important methodological and diagnostic considerations for COMISA, and review several recent randomized controlled trials investigating the combination of CBTi and CPAP therapy. We aim to provide clinicians with pragmatic suggestions and tools to identify, and manage this prevalent COMISA disorder in clinical settings, and discuss future avenues of research to progress the field.

ABSTRACTArchaeologists’ newfound ability to access vast digital collections creates opportunities but also presents challenges when those collections are from varied sources, including public institutions and private collectors. We illustrate these challenges by comparing two analyses of gender in Mimbres pottery images. Both analyses used the same procedures, but one included material in private collections, while the second drew on a smaller but more controlled sample. Gender distinctions and division of labor were revealed by the first analysis, but the results were not duplicated in the reanalysis using the controlled sample. We consider reasons for the difference, addressing how collectors’ interests may skew collections and suggesting that some particularly desirable Mimbres pottery designs were created using modern paint. The article concludes with recommendations for how archaeologists can best use mixed collections. These include considering how collections might be skewed and designing analyses to counterbalance likely issues, more chemical analyses with representative samples to gauge the extent of modern manipulation of Mimbres vessels, collecting data on the provenance (i.e., collection history) of material in order to try to trace the likelihood of post-excavation modifications, and studying the process of collecting as a means of understanding the authenticity of artifacts.

Karl Jaspers belongs with his Strindberg and van Gogh: An attempt of a pathographic analysis in comparative relation to Swedenborg and Hölderlin (1922) to the classic representatives of the genre. He developed this way of thinking psychiatrically and philosophically even more clearly in the extensive case history incorporated into his 1936 monograph Nietzsche: An Introduction to the Understanding of His Philosophical Activity. Jaspers addressed the issue of pathography a third time in 1947 when he formulated a clinical casuistry of the prophet Ezekiel for a Festschrift dedicated to Kurt Schneider. The article at hand explores the three pathographical studies conducted by Jaspers in the context of a history of ideas. It will focus initially on three exemplary representatives of modern pathography. Then Jaspers’ approach will be introduced, starting with methodological considerations followed by three sections devoted to detailed analyses of his pathographical studies. Lastly, Jaspers’ philosophical premises will be explored in greater detail.

Verbal and visuospatial memory and dichotic listening performance were examined in 15 acutely depressed patients with no history of ECT, 17 depressed patients currently in remission, 15 remitted depressed patients who had received ECT six months or more in the past, and 20 normal controls. The neuropsychological functioning of an additional group of 10 acutely depressed patients was also studied before and two weeks after ECT. The results revealed some evidence of logical and autobiographical memory impairment two weeks following ECT, but no evidence that ECT impaired dichotic listening ability. Rather, a normalisation of hemispheric laterality was apparent on the dichotic listening task following ECT and the concomitant relief from depression. There was also no evidence of cognitive dysfunction on any task in individuals who were tested six months or more following their last ECT treatment.

Theories in cognitive science have debated whether visual selective attention is a space-based or object-based process To investigate this issue, we applied a new experimental paradigm that permits the simultaneous measurement of both space-based and object-based attention to a split-brain patient with disconnected cerebral hemispheres The data demonstrate both space-based and object-based components to the allocation of attention, and reveal that the two processes have different neural substrates These findings are related to previous research on split-brain and unilateral parietal patients
